Why is Submission tracking only 8 moths when Turn Around Times are getting longer than that?
I submitted a book in April 2021, and it was opened in May of 2021. Submitted for grading and pressing. I had asked about the books status in October 2021 and was told that current Turn Around Time for CCS was 200 working days. In January I had to ask again because my submission had fallen off the submission board and the tracking number wasn't working. In January I was told the CCS Turn around time was now 229 working days. At the beginning of March I saw the Turn around times were now listed at 249 working days, and looking again today (23MAR2022) Turn around time has jumped to 281 working days.
And that time is only the CCS function, then it has to go back through Grading services which currently has a Turn around time of 122 Working days. Even if those time table don't expand again until my book is through that is an estimate 403 working days until my book makes it through the entire process. There are only about 260 working days in a calendar year.
When I try and use the number tracking for my submission 3849564 it errors out. I was also told by CGC Customer Service back in January that they knew the Submission Tracker was having issues.
"Unfortunately, we are currently experiencing some issues with the submission tracking. Some invoices are not displaying properly, even when the information is entered in the search bar. We are working on that problem now and hope to have that fixed ASAP."
Can CGC remove the 8 month limit on displaying submissions?
If Not, can CGC fix the submission tracking feature?
Can CGC notify customers when Turn Around Times are drawn out?
I don't like being kept in the dark about the status of my book. It shouldn't take an act of god to find out the basic status.

I had the artist Dave Ryan draw a cover sketch last year. Dave sent it to me with the required paperwork for his listing on a signature series cover. I then directly met with a CGC Authorized Facilitator at Awesome Con last year to get George Takei's signature on the book. I got the book back today with a Green CGC Signature Qualified Grade label. It has George Takei listed, but the only says 'Name & Sketch written on Cover'. I don't understand what happened. Has this happened to anyone before?
